The UMDNJ Graduate School of Biomedical Sciences at Robert Wood Johnson Medical School offers interdisciplinary training in specialties including Biochemistry, Pharmacology, Physiology, Environmental Exposure, Molecular Genetics, Biomedical Engineering, Toxicology, and Neuroscience.  These graduate training programs are offered jointly with Rutgers, the State University of New Jersey Graduate School New Brunswick on our Piscataway and New Brunswick campuses.

In addition, a new Masters in Clinical and Translational Sciences from the GSBS at RWJMS has launched Fall 2009.
